San Jacinto County
Favorability to Plaintiff:
5 (Neutral)
Summary:
An East–Southeast Texas, largely rural exurb with lake development and a commuting population, it still feels like country living even as Houston’s growth improves demographics, plaintiff access, and metro benefits. The economy mixes rural and industrial work, which creates moderate plaintiff sympathy, but there’s no major verdict history and the county grades out at a moderate score. Juries are somewhat conservative: plaintiffs can win on compelling facts, yet high damages are uncommon. Bottom line: a difficult venue overall, improving at the margins, but still measured on awards.
